Need a large loan? Why a home loan may cost less than a loan against property
MeridStreet AI summaryA home loan may be cheaper than a loan against property for those who need a large loan. This is because home loans often have lower interest rates and more favorable loan-to-value rules compared to loans against property. As a result, homeowners may be able to borrow more money at a lower cost, making a home loan a more attractive option for large loan requirements. This difference in pricing can have significant implications for borrowers, particularly those with substantial financial needs.
